The candy Bar game...you put on the invite...BRING YOUR FAVORITE CANDY BAR..
Then you have 10 things...
1. If you brought your own candy bar ---2 pts
2. If your candy bar is KING SIZE ---1 pt
3.If it has peanuts---1 pt
4.If it has coconut SUBTRACT 1 pt
5. If it is in 2 pieces--2 pts
6.If you the only one with that kind of candy bar--2 pts
7. If you bought your candy bar on the way here SUBTRACT 1 pt
8. If it is dark chocolate--1 pt
9. If you brought more than one---2 pts
10.Give yourself 1 pt for each letter in your candy bar name.

Then total the points.....I usually will give a small prize to the lowest score and the bigger prize to the high score...
